This makes the build configuration more robust to added and removed files. See also the analogous PR in ROOT, as well as the corresponding Jira ticket: * root-project/root#3259 * https://its.cern.ch/jira/browse/ROOT-5998 Like this, we also don't need to "comment out" whole source files with preprocessor macros, like the `TPyClassGenerator`. This also helps ROOT, which requires these sources, because then the sources can be used as-is.

I wouldn't uncomment the TPyClassGenerator file as it really can't compile at this point. It accesses ROOT headers directly rather than clingwrapper APIs. The point of that file was to make Python classes usable from Cling. It's a cute feature, but no-one really ever cared about it, since callbacks (through a C++ base class) are easier to deal with. |
